Vladimir Jovanović is the new Budućnost VOLI head coach

Wednesday, 13. July 2022 at 11:21

The Čačak-born tactician will take over the helm of the club of Podgorica and will lead it in the forthcoming period.

Vladimir Jovanovic (Photo: Zadar/Zvonko Kucelin)

For five years Vladimir Jovanović used to be a right hand of the head coach Duško Vujošević at Partizan NIS of Belgrade, until becoming a head coach himself. With only 38 years of age he won the regional league trophy in the Final Four, where he prevailed in the Semi-finals against the club that he is taking over now in a close finish.

After Partizan NIS he moved to Donetsh, Igokea m:tel, only to sign with the Lokomotiv Kuban, where he used to work on developing talented players of the Russian club basketball. He also used to lead the Shenzen Leopards in China, before becoming Mega MIS head coach.

In the Belgrade squad he is remembered for his excellent work with youngsters.
